24 | Baton Pass in 4:07:28 | Run: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=QXko-5TqSEE | |
25 | - | Alt Main Poke: Dratini+ in 4:15:04 | https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=NPzCo_eC8oM |
25 | + | This might be the most fun category I routed and ran this year. "Baton Pass" is a category where you use different Pokemon for every "Main" fight, those being Gym Leaders, E4/Champ, and Ghetsis. Which leads to some great fun, as which Pokes you use actually vary every run depending on what you encounter and catch. Was really fun to do a few times, and wouldn't mind doing it more again in the future. |
